About the role
Issgh is currently seeking an Accountant Assistant to join their growing team in Rio de Janeiro. This full-time position provides essential support to the accounting department by handling daily financial tasks and maintaining accurate records. The Accountant Assistant will work closely with senior accounting professionals to ensure that all financial documentation is properly organized and up to date. Responsibilities include processing invoices, assisting with bank reconciliations, and helping prepare reports that support the broader financial operations at Issgh. The role is integral to keeping the finance function running smoothly and ensuring that internal and external stakeholders receive timely and accurate financial information.

What you'll do
- Assist with daily bookkeeping tasks including recording financial transactions and updating ledger entries in the system
- Help prepare invoices and verify that all billing documents are complete and accurate before submission
- Support the reconciliation of bank statements and internal accounts on a regular weekly basis
- Organize and maintain both physical and digital financial files for easy retrieval and future reference
- Assist with payroll processing by collecting and verifying employee time and attendance records each pay period
- Help prepare monthly financial reports and summarize key accounting data for review by management
- Coordinate with other departments to ensure proper documentation of expenses and supporting receipts are filed
- Participate in periodic inventory counts and assist with recording any inventory adjustments in the system
- Support audit preparation by gathering and organizing requested financial documentation and supporting records
- Help ensure compliance with internal accounting policies and local regulatory filing requirements at all times
- Contribute to month end closing procedures by assisting with accruals and prepayments entries
- Aid in the preparation of tax related documentation and supporting schedules as needed
- Assist with the preparation of journal entries and ensure they are properly documented and approved
- Monitor and track outstanding accounts receivable and assist with sending reminders for overdue payments
